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Apennine Shrew | アマツバメ |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(動物) | Animalia (動物)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(脊索動物) | Chordata (脊索動物) |
| Class | Mammalia (哺乳類) | Aves (鳥類) |
| Order | Soricomorpha (トガリネズミ目) | Apodiformes (アマツバメ目) |
| Family | Soricidae | Apodidae |
| Genus | Sorex | Apus |
| Species | Sorex samniticus | Apus pacificus |
Evolutionary Relationship
Apennine Shrew and アマツバメ share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(脊索動物)
